We are currently seeking reliable and hardworking Class 2 Drivers to join our team of drivers with our client in waste management.
Key Responsibilities:
- Driving a company Class 2 vehicle
- Loading and unloading
- Carrying out manual handling tasks
- Ensuring all deliveries are completed efficiently and on time
- Maintaining vehicle cleanliness and reporting any issues
- Completing delivery paperwork and records accurately
Requirements:
- Full UK driving licence (no more than 6 points preferred)
- Ability to carry out manual handling tasks safely
- Good time management and organisational skills
- Strong work ethic and reliability
What We Offer:
- Competitive hourly rate of £20.00
- Regular working hours
- Supportive team environment
- Opportunities for overtime
